gtk 开发实践第一篇
来源:互联网 发布:淘宝网开网店 编辑:程序博客网 时间:2024/06/06 04:47
前面已经实验安装成功了gtk+。
这一篇文章,我们来实践一下怎样来编写自己地gtk+ 程序。
新建一个工程,在main.c中添加代码:
#include <gtk/gtk.h>int main( int argc, char *argv[]){ GtkWidget *window; gtk_init(&argc, &argv); window = gtk_window_new(GTK_WINDOW_TOPLEVEL); gtk_widget_show(window); gtk_main(); return 0;}
编译并执行出现一个空白窗体(linux下在命令行下执行),即代表gtk+的开发环境配置成功了。顺便说下可以直接用gcc命令行生成:
gcc -o hello-world main.c `pkg-config --cflags --libs gtk+-2.0`
下面是在windows 7 和 linux(centos) 下的效果
0 0
- gtk 开发实践第一篇
- gtk 开发实践第二篇
- gtk 开发实践第三篇
- 一小时用起 git :git开发实践第一篇
- iphone 开发第一篇
- 第一篇 Web开发
- 软工实践第一篇随笔-准备
- 第一篇 搭建开发环境
- Ebay Api开发第一篇
- Android APP 开发第一篇
- STM32开发手记第一篇
- React Native 开发(第一篇)
- nodejs开发指南第一篇
- 微信开发第一篇
- GTK开发
- 日本的开发习惯 第一篇
- 第一篇关于 java excel 开发
- 第一篇 开发环境的搭建
- BZOJ 1901 Zju2112 Dynamic Rankings 树套"树"
- 第六周上机实践项目-书面作业2
- SOCKET通信中TCP、UDP数据包大小的确定
- 晶振
- CF 628B. New Skateboard
- gtk 开发实践第一篇
- 【POJ2891】Strange Way to Express Integers——中国剩余定理(非互质)
- Lua中rawset和rawget的使用方法
- 上拉加载XListView
- ArrayList and LinkedList Demo
- 5-10 计算工资 (15分)
- 【JQuery】使用each()方法遍历元素
- [Unity热更新]tolua# & LuaFramework(三):lua使用list与事件委托
- JAVA 抽象路径